The Madalorian is coming to the D23 Expo in Anaheim, California, next month, and that’s just one piece of a massive Star Wars presence at the three-day Disney event.

For the first time at D23 Expo, Lucasfilm will host a pavilion on the show floor. Fans will get an up-close look at screen-used costumes from the iconic film series, including an encore presentation of the Stormtrooper evolution exhibit that will make its debut at Comic-Con International: San Diego (SDCC) next week, including the Sith Trooper from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ker.

The Lucasfilm pavilion will also have an interactive section for kids, centered around the Star Wars Galaxy of Adventures shorts.

During the Disney+ panel on Friday, Aug. 23, at 3:30 p.m., attendees in Hall D23 can check out a sneak preview of the first-ever, live-action Star Wars series when showrunner Jon Favreau takes the stage with special guests, including Dave Filoni (supervising director on Star Wars: The Clone Wars and writer/director on The Mandalorian). In the new series, Pedro Pascal stars as the title character — “a bounty hunter who travels the outer reaches of the lawless galaxy, surviving as a mercenary-for-hire.”

Tickets for D23 Expo are moving fast, with single-day Saturday tickets and three-day passes already sold out.
